With less than two weeks until the midterms, MNN’s Race to Represent is here to bring you more from your candidates. Listen to their thoughts on issues that matter to you, and get to know where they stand on critical issues such as the decriminalization of marijuana, combatting overdevelopment in city neighborhoods, and fixing the unreliable MTA system.

This Wednesday night, watch State Senator Brian Kavanagh and his Republican challenger Anthony Arias debate the issues affecting Lower Manhattan (District 26). Then, tune in to an interview with Democratic Assembly Member Richard Gottfried (District 75 - Murray Hill, Chelsea, Clinton, Midtown West, UWS).

Tune in on Wednesday, October 24, at 8 pm on MNN1 (Spectrum 34 & 1995, RCN 82, FiOS 33), MNNHD (Spectrum 1993) or MNN's YouTube channel.
